Que signifie ce verset ?

In Exodus 35:4, Moses speaks to the entire community of Israelites, reminding them of a command from the Lord. This verse emphasizes the importance of following divine instructions as communicated through Moses.

Contexte historique

This verse is part of the Book of Exodus, written by Moses around 1446-1406 BCE. It was directed to the Israelites after their escape from Egypt, as they were preparing to build the tabernacle. The cultural setting was one of transition, where the Israelites were learning to follow God's laws and instructions.

Questions fréquentes

Who is speaking in Exodus 35:4?
Moses is speaking to the Israelites, conveying a message from God.
What is the main message of Exodus 35:4?
The main message is about obedience to God's commands, especially as communicated through Moses.
How does this verse relate to building the tabernacle?
This verse sets the stage for the instructions that follow, which are about the construction of the tabernacle according to God's specifications.
